Female footballer refuses to pay respect to Diego Maradona over ‘rape’, and ‘sexism’

Paula Dapena, 24, is well-known among her teammates for being a woman of strong feminist ideals

Newsroom November 30 11:02

Tributes have been paid to the late Diego Maradona at sporting events across the world over the weekend after the Argentine legend’s death mid-week, from the New Zealand All Blacks paying homage to the famous number 10 before their game against Argentina to Lionel Messi revealing a replica of his Newell’s Old Boys jersey in honour of his compatriot.

However, one female player refused to stand during a minute’s silence before a women’s friendly match between Viajes Interrias FF and Deportivo Abanca in Coruña, Spain — instead choosing to sit on the floor with her back turned while the rest of the players stood with their heads bowed in respect.

Paula Dapena, a 24-year-old player for Viajes Interrias FF, is well-known among her teammates for being a woman of strong feminist ideals. When she arrived at the ground in Abegondo, she revealed that she had not been aware that there would be a minute’s silence for Maradona.

“As soon as I found out that there would be an act in his memory I refused to observe the minute’s silence for a rapist, paedophile and abuser,” Dapena said.
